Junius, Hadrianus, Heemskerck, Maarten van, Haarlem, Galle, Philips, History of Shadrach, Meshach and Abednego, Nebuchadnezzar sees that Shadrach, Meshach and Abednego are unharmed, Nebuchadnezzar comes to look at the furnace and sees with amazement that Shadrach, Meshach and Abednego remain unharmed. He also sees a fourth man standing among them with a halo. On the ground in front of the furnace lie the burned guards. Below the representation is an explanatory text in Latin.
